Understanding the Multiplier and Crash Mechanics
The heart of the experience revolves around the multiplier. It begins at 1x and steadily climbs as time progresses. The longer the round lasts, the higher the multiplier goes, and consequently, the bigger the potential payout. However, at a random point, the round will 'crash,' and any players who haven't cashed out before this happens will lose their stake. This unpredictable crash point is determined by a provably fair random number generator (RNG), ensuring that the game’s outcomes are unbiased and transparent. Understanding how this RNG functions is key to recognizing that previous results don't influence future occurrences. Each round is independent, making it impossible to predict with certainty when the multiplier will crash.

Effective Betting Strategies for Aviator
While the game is based on chance, employing a structured betting strategy can significantly improve your odds of success. One popular approach is the Martingale system, which involves doubling your stake after each loss, with the aim of recovering previous losses and securing a small profit. However, this system requires a substantial bankroll and can quickly lead to significant losses if a losing streak persists. Another strategy is the Fibonacci sequence, where you increase your stake based on the Fibonacci numbers (1, 1, 2, 3, 5, 8, etc.) after each loss, and decrease it by two steps after a win. This method is less aggressive than the Martingale system but still requires careful bankroll management.
It’s also essential to avoid chasing losses. When experiencing a series of unsuccessful rounds, resisting the temptation to increase your stake dramatically is crucial. Emotional decision-making can lead to impulsive bets and further losses. Instead, take a break, reassess your strategy, and return with a clear head. The Importance of Bankroll Management
Effective bankroll management is arguably the most crucial aspect of playing the aviator game. Before you begin, determine how much money you're willing to risk and strictly adhere to that limit. Never bet more than a small percentage of your bankroll on a single round – a common recommendation is 1% to 5%. This ensures that you can withstand losing streaks without depleting your funds. Divide your bankroll into smaller units, and treat each unit as a separate betting opportunity. This prevents you from making hasty decisions based on short-term wins or losses. Regularly review your results and adjust your strategy as needed.
Consider setting win and loss limits. If you reach your predetermined win target, cash out and enjoy your profits. Similarly, if you reach your loss limit, stop playing and avoid the temptation to recoup your losses. Utilizing Automated Betting Tools and Features
Many platforms offering the aviator game provide automated betting tools and features to assist players. These can include auto-cashout functionality, which allows you to set a desired multiplier, and the game automatically cashes out your bet when that multiplier is reached. This is particularly useful for players who want to execute a specific strategy consistently without manual intervention. Another feature often available is auto-betting, where you can specify your stake amount and the number of rounds to play automatically. Careful consideration should be given to the settings before automating your bets as it removes the real-time input.
While these tools can be helpful, they should not be relied upon blindly. It’s important to understand the limitations of automated betting and to monitor the results regularly. Technical glitches or unforeseen circumstances can sometimes occur, leading to unintended outcomes. Furthermore, automated betting can remove the element of strategic adaptation, which is often crucial for success in a dynamic game like aviator.
Understanding Provably Fair Technology
A key feature associated with modern aviator games is 'provably fair' technology. This mechanism ensures that each round's outcome is transparently verifiable. Typically, this involves cryptographic hashing and seed values. Players have the ability to confirm that the results are not manipulated by the operator. Understanding the principles behind provably fair technology builds trust and confidence in the integrity of the game. It is a significant step forward in promoting fairness and transparency in online gambling.
The algorithm used ensures that neither the player nor the operator can influence the outcome. By providing a public record of the game's randomness, the provably fair system enhances accountability and prevents any form of cheating. Players can independently verify the fairness of each round, giving them greater peace of mind. This transparency is a key differentiator of modern aviator platforms versus older, less trustworthy operations.
